  15. Count_Zero

    We Were All New D&D Players Once

    My rule of thumb, on the small handful of occasions where I've run games (which was also for new players), was that at the end of any session, before level 3, the new player could re-spec. By the time they hit level 3, they should have a pretty good idea of how to play their class.
